snoop1130 Posted August 11, 2020 Share Posted August 11, 2020 DSI raids net Bt100m worth of fake goods, Chinese national arrested By The Nation The Department of Special Investigation (DSI) raided eight warehouses in Bangkok on Tuesday (August 11) and confiscated counterfeit brand-name products valued at more than Bt100 million. The largest warehouse, where copies of expensive brands like Louis Vuitton, Gucci and Coach were stored, is located in Phasi Charoen district’s Khlong Khwang area. Pol Lt-Colonel Korrawat Panprapakorn, DSI director-general, said the raids were planned after police tracked down the source of fake products. Police also arrested a Chinese national, who is reportedly married to a Thai woman and ran the business by bringing the products from China to sell online in Thailand. He was charged with selling counterfeit goods and will be investigated for legal prosecution.
